Certified Trauma Integration Mentor (CTIM) is intended fo those who wish to foster change to create trauma-informed communities and organizations through raising awareness and sharing information about our approach. Further details to follow.
Application Process: Intake package and in-person interview
Includes the following:
a) Trainings Level 1 & 2
b) Background readings
c) Submit a video of one session of your work
d) 1 hour tele-conference training focused on skills required for general group leaders
e) Monthly teleconference supervision or consultation
f) Submit evaluations on an-on going basis.
*Note the steps taken to become a mentor can be applied to becoming a facilitator (this is a complimentary process).
